Wong This testcase exercises what happens when we race a filesystem perforing discard operations against a thin provisioning device that has run out of space. To constrain runtime, it creates a 128M thinp volume and formats it. However, if that initial format fails because (say) the 128M volume is too small, then the test fails. This is really a case of test preconditions not being satisfied, so let's make the test _notrun when this happens. Signed-off-by: Darrick J.
